Data Processing Notes: ---------------------- Fluorescence and PAR data are nominal and unedited except that some records were removed in editing temperature and salinity and a large spike in fluorescence was removed from file 0032. The Transmissivity channel was removed because of frequent shifts in values during casts and large variations between values during repeat casts. The data are available, by request, from the chief scientist. NOTE: While the Fluorescence:CTD data are expressed in concentration units, they do not always compare well to extracted chlorophyll samples, particularly for casts far from shore. It is recommended that users check extracted chlorophyll values where available. Oxygen:Dissolved:CTD was calibrated using the method described in Sea-Bird Application Note #64-2, June 2012 revision (Sea-Bird_64-2_Jun2012.pdf), except that a small offset in the fit was allowed. The Dissolved Oxygen sensor used in files 0001, 0002 and 0016 malfunctioned so the Oxygen:Dissolved:CTD channels were removed from those files. The Oxygen:Dissolved:CTD sensor has a fairly long response time so data accuracy is not as high when it is in motion as it is during stops for bottles. This will be especially true when vertical dissolved oxygen gradients are large. To get an estimate of the accuracy of the Oxygen:Dissolved:CTD data during downcasts (after recalibration) a rough comparison was made between downcast Oxygen:Dissolved:CTD data and upcast titrated samples. Some of the difference will be due to problems with flushing of Niskin bottles and/or analysis errors, so the following statement likely underestimates Oxygen:Dissolved:CTD accuracy. Downcast (CTD files) Oxygen:Dissolved:CTD data are considered, very roughly, to be: ±0.25 ml/l from 0 to 125 dbar. ±0.2 ml/l from 125 to 400 dbar. ±0.1 ml/l from 400 to 600 dbar. ±0.05 ml/l from 600 to 1500 dbar. Low by up to 0.08 ml/l below 1500 dbar.
